A083164 Rearrangement of natural numbers such that n divides sum of the terms with index which are the divisors of n. +0
3
1, 3, 2, 4, 9, 6, 13, 8, 15, 7, 10, 20, 12, 11, 18, 16, 33, 27, 37, 36, 5, 30, 22, 28, 40, 62, 63, 24, 57, 14, 61, 32, 53, 31, 47, 66, 73, 35, 102, 52, 81, 43, 42, 84, 45, 112, 46, 56, 133, 90, 117, 74, 105, 99, 145, 48, 17, 55, 58, 60, 121, 59, 153, 64, 108, 93, 200, 132 (list; graph; listen)
